A truly excellent example of a fine wisconsin lager. This is my second favorite wisconsin beer next to Point Special. Excellent malty flavor, especially when its on tap. Good carbonation, a really good beer that goes down really easy.

Best of the class when talking about an American Lager! Excellent Flavor Carbonation, color, very drinkable, not watery. Not a complicated flavor, but not expected when sampling an American Lager. Best of the Leininkugels family. Other leinenkugels beers are not for beer drinkers. Also, very cheap here in MN. Knocks the pants off any offerings from Budweiser, Miller, Coors, or any other common American Lager Best in its class!.
